Dr Pane is a University of Queensland graduate who undertook his eye specialist training in the Brisbane hospitals.
 
In 2004 he returned from three years advanced training in the United Kingdom to join the Queensland Eye Institute.Although Dr Pane's practice covers general adult ophthalmology, including cataract surgery, his special clinical and research interest is in neuro-ophthalmology.
 
This is the branch of ophthalmology dealing with diseases of the brain and nerves which can cause blurred vision, double vision, or abnormal eye movements.  One of Dr Pane's key interests is in improving outcomes for patients by developing a method for ophthalmologists to detect and diagnose serious causes of optic nerve disease earlier and more accurately.
 
He is currently pursuing his PhD in this area.Dr Pane has recently written two practical textbooks of ophthalmology which have been published internationally. His third book, on neuro-ophthalmology, is now a standard text for trainee eye surgeons in major teaching hospitals throughout the USA, UK and Europe.  Senior Lecturer in Ophthalmology at the University of Queensland, Dr Pane enjoys teaching trainee ophthalmologists and medical students.
